Government code subsections 403.302(J) AND(K) require the Comptroller to certify alternative measures of school district wealth.These measures are reported for taxable values for maintenance and operation(M & O) tax purposes and for interest and sinking fund(I & S) tax purposes.For districts that have not entered into value limitation agreements, T1 through T4 will be the same as T7 through T10.

T1 = School district taxable value for M & O purposes before the loss to the increase in the state-mandated homestead exemption

T2 = School district taxable value for M & O purposes after the loss to the increase in the state-mandated homestead exemption and the tax ceiling reduction


T3 = T1 minus 50% of the loss to the local optional percentage homestead exemption

T4 = T2 minus 50% of the loss to the local optional percentage homestead exemption

T13 = T1 plus the cost of the second most recent increase for that PVS Year in the mandatory homestead exemptions

Value Taxable For I & S Purposes

T7 T8 T9 T10 T14
4,332,662,279 4,196,390,346 3,989,573,189 3,853,301,256 4,424,102,279

T7 = School district taxable value for I & S purposes before the loss to the increase in the state-mandated homestead exemption

T8 = School district taxable value for I & S purposes after the loss to the increase in the state-mandated homestead exemption and the tax
ceiling reduction


T9 = T7 minus 50 % of the loss to the local optional percentage homestead exemption

T10 = T8 minus 50 % of the loss to the local optional percentage homestead exemption

T14 = T13 plus the loss to the chapter 313 agreement
